You guys know me, I'm not someone to dissect every poll that shows me something I don't like and I also have defended Trafalgar in the past, so I like to think this isn't the partisan hack within me that's talking right now. All that said, I think I'm done with Trafalgar. They expect me to believe that Wisconsin, PA, Washington, Georgia, and now Colorado Senate are in the exact same place as each other, and that Kansas, NY, Oregon, and Michigan governor are also all in the same place as those Senate races. That's not possible, and I also think that it's statistically impossible (and yes, I'm using that annoying term) for them to conduct so many polls and get every race within a couple points. I don't believe it.

I'm calling it now, any races Trafalgar gets right is sheer luck & wishful thinking. The only reason they're likely to be closer to reality than other pollsters is because literally guessing and making up fake numbers is more accurate than whatever the other pollsters are doing, lol!
